Restless Legs Syndrome
Conditions
Brief summary
The purpose of this study is to evaluate the efficacy and safety of cabergoline compared with levodopa in the treatment of patients with RLS.
Interventions
Cabergoline oral tablets: 0.5 mg daily on Days 1 to 3, 1.0 mg daily on Days 4 to 7, 1.5 mg daily on Days 8 to 10, and 2.0 mg daily on Days 11 to 14 and then administered as a stable dose for a further 4 weeks; at Week 6, dose could be increased to 3 mg daily if patient experienced insufficient efficacy without impairing adverse events
Levodopa oral capsules: 25 mg twice daily on Days 1 to 3, 50 mg twice daily on Days 4 to 7, 100 mg twice daily on Days 8 to 14 and then administered as a stable dose for a further 4 weeks; at Week 6, dose could be increased to 150 mg twice daily if patient experienced insufficient efficacy without impairing adverse events

Eligibility
Inclusion criteria
* Diagnosis of idiopathic RLS and had all 4 clinical manifestations of RLS * Moderate to severe symptoms of RLS as indicated by an IRLSSG-RS total score greater than or equal to 10 and a severity at night score of greater than or equal to 4 on an 11-point RLS-6 rating scale * No previous treatment for RLS or dissatisfaction with their current therapy

Design outcomes
Primary
| Measure | Time frame |
|---|---|
| Change from baseline in the total score of the International RLS Study Group Rating Scale (IRLSSG-RS) | Week 6 |
| Time to dropout due to a necessary change in RLS therapy because of augmentation or loss of efficacy (e.g., dose increment of study drug, switch to another therapy, or start of a drug-free period) | — |
Secondary
| Measure | Time frame |
|---|---|
| Patient Global Impression | Weeks 6 and 30 |
| Sleep questionnaire form A | Weeks 6 and 30 |
| IRLSSG-RS | Week 30 |
| Safety evaluation including adverse events, clinically relevant changes in laboratory data, physical exam findings, and abnormalities observed in electrocardiogram | Weeks 2, 6, and 8 during Period 1 and every 4 weeks during Period 2 |
| RLS quality-of-life questionnaire | Weeks 6 and 30 |
| Rating of severity of RLS before bedtime (RLS-6 scale) | Weeks 6 and 30 |
| Rating of severity of RLS at day when at rest and during activities, severity of daytime sleepiness (RLS-6 scales) | Weeks 6 and 30 |
| Global rating of quality of sleep (RLS-6 scale) | Weeks 6 and 30 |
| Rating of severity of RLS at night (RLS-6 scale) | Weeks 6 and 30 |
| Clinical Global Impression | Weeks 6 and 30 |
